Bol was a highly successful artist in Amsterdam, but like several slightly later pupils and followers of Rembrandt he came from the South Holland city of Dordrecht. His teacher there is not named in documents, but Jacob Gerritsz Cuyp (1594–1651/52), father of Aelbert Cuyp (1620–1691) and the most prominent painter in Dordrecht at the time, is a likely candidate
